Highlights
Are people in Boston older or younger than people in Warren?
- The Median Age in Boston is 15.0 years younger than in Warren.

Are housing costs cheaper in Boston or Warren?
- Boston housing costs are 59.6% more expensive than Warren hous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Boston or Warren?
- The average commute for residents of Boston is 5.5 minutes longer than it is for residents of Warren.

Things to do in Boston?
Boston, Massachusetts is a bustling metropolitan city with plenty to offer. From the renowned Freedom Trail and Fenway Park to the scenic Charles River and Beacon Hill, visitors of all ages will find something to do in this historic city. Tour Harvard University or take a walk through the cobblestone streets of Beacon Hill and see why it's known as one of America's most charming cities. From art and history museums to sports venues and delicious seafood restaurants, Boston has it all for anyone looking for an unforgettable experience.
